Fútbol, cuantificación, técnico-táctica, enseñanza, aprendizaje (Soccer, quantification, technical-tactical, education, learning)Abstract
El objetivo que buscamos con este trabajo es el de ofrecer a los técnicos de fútbol base una herramienta que les permita cuantificar el rendimiento técnico-táctico de sus jugadores y así saber en que sentido han de mejorar los mismos o hacia donde ha de focalizar los procesos de enseñanza-aprendizaje. Desde hace unos años se viene desarrollando una amplia discusión científica entre los partidarios de una iniciación deportiva centrada en el conocimiento táctico del juego y aquellos otros que optan por una visión más mecanicista y consideran oportuno comenzar con la enseñanza de la técnica, para después ir abordando conceptos tácticos. La técnica no tiene ningún sentido sin la táctica, pero ésta no podrá ver cumplidos sus objetivos sin la ayuda de aquella.
Abstract: Our main objective is to provide minor league soccer coaches of a tool to quantify the technical-tactical performance of their players bothfor assessment and further planning.The question if the teachhing of games should be firstly based on the development of the tactical awareness rattherthan the mechanical aspects of the skills has been running for several years on. Definitively, technic makes no sense without tactics but tacticalobjectives are harder made without sound tecnical foundations.
